Texas Atty General Abbott has spent over $2.2 Million defending racially biased redistricting

Billing records released by Texas Attorney General Greg Abbott reveal that his office has spent $2.2 million to defend a state redistricting map that federal judges ruled “intentionally discriminates” against Latinos, African Americans and other minorities. Recent news articles reported less than half of these costs.
